Cabinets, Lockers in Windsor
MisterWhat has found 1 results for Cabinets, Lockers in Windsor.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Darem Hardware
1558 Windsor Avenue
Windsor, ON N8X 3M4
1558 Windsor Avenue
Windsor, ON N8X 3M4